Primary Purpose

Under direct supervision, perform data entry including accounting, personnel, budget, demographics, or Public Education Information Management System (PEIMS) data; attendance; or grades into computer databases.

Records and Reports

Enters alphabetic, numeric, or symbolic data from source document using online computer terminal or personal computer.Collect and enter PEIMS data into established database and verify accuracy according to prescribed procedures.Maintain student records and process requests for student information and transcripts. Process new student records, including requesting transcripts and records from other schools.Verifies PEIMS data results according to procedures provided.Recognizes and corrects errors in original data prior to processing.Recognizes deficiencies in source documents and returns them to originator for correction.Prints reports using database information including attendance reports, class or personnel rosters, end-of-semester reports, or accounting reports.Professional Conduct:
